Nouns

(n)shedan outbuilding with a single story; used for shelter or storage

Verbs

(v)shed, cast, cast off, shake off, throw, throw off, throw away, dropto remove“he shed his image as a pushy boss”, “shed your clothes”
(v)spill, shed, pour forthpour out in drops or small quantities or as if in drops or small quantities“shed tears”, “spill blood”, “God shed His grace on Thee”
(v)spill, shed, disgorgecause or allow (a solid substance) to flow or run out or over“spill the beans all over the table”
(v)shed, molt, exuviate, moult, sloughcast off hair, skin, horn, or feathers“our dog sheds every Spring”

Adjectives

(a)caducous, shedshed at an early stage of development“most amphibians have caducous gills”, “the caducous calyx of a poppy”
